Resumo

DC and microwave properties of granular superconducting bridges made of YBCO thin films have been investigated experimentally. The resistance of a microbridge increased step-wise at increasing bias. Microwave radiation, with a bandwidth of 300 MHz, has been observed with maximum amplitudes at certain dc-biases. The do and rf properties may be explained within a model with coherent motion of hyper-vortices that are larger than grain sizes.
